PCOD Diet Plans from Indore's Leading Nutritionists: What You Need to Know

  Polycystic Ovary Disease (PCOD) affects millions of women worldwide, causing hormonal imbalances that impact menstruation, fertility, and overall health. While medical treatment is essential, adopting the right diet can significantly improve symptoms and help manage the condition. In Indore, some leading nutritionists have developed effective PCOD diet plans that can support hormonal balance, weight management, and overall well-being. 1. Balanced Blood Sugar Levels One of the key components of a PCOD diet is managing insulin resistance, which is common among women with PCOD. Leading nutritionists in Indore recommend focusing on low glycemic index (GI) foods such as whole grains, vegetables, and fruits. These foods help in preventing sudden blood sugar spikes and crashes, which can worsen PCOD symptoms like weight gain and fatigue. 2.
